So what other fascinating facts are there about our canine friends?
A dog can run up to nineteen miles per hour when running at full speed., but the members of the greyhound family are the fastest, they can run up to 42 miles per hour.
Small dogs live the longest. Toy breeds live up to 16 years or more. Larger dogs average is
7 - 12 years. Veterinary medicine have extended this estimate by about three years. However, some breeds, such as Tibetan terrier live as long as twenty years.
A dog's nose works 1 million times more efficiently than the human nose. Some dogs have better noses than others. Some dogs have the ability to sniff out suitcases filled with drugs.
Did you know the average dog has 42 permanent teeth in his mouth
A dog's hearing is much greater than a humans, especially for high-pitched should. Dogs can hears sounds that are ultrasonic. If a dog suddenly pricks up its ears and becomes alert for no apparent reason, he might have detected bat or rodent sounds that are not heard by us!
